- 全國(guó)計(jì)算機(jī)等級(jí)考試一本通:二級(jí)Visual Basic
- 全國(guó)計(jì)算機(jī)等級(jí)考試命題研究中心 未來(lái)教育教學(xué)與研究中心
- 959字
- 2020-08-24 18:14:30
考點(diǎn)2 數(shù)據(jù)結(jié)構(gòu)的基本概念
1.數(shù)據(jù)結(jié)構(gòu)的定義
數(shù)據(jù)結(jié)構(gòu)是指相互有關(guān)聯(lián)的數(shù)據(jù)元素的集合,即數(shù)據(jù)的組織形式。
(1)數(shù)據(jù)的邏輯結(jié)構(gòu)。
所謂數(shù)據(jù)的邏輯結(jié)構(gòu),是指反映數(shù)據(jù)元素之間邏輯關(guān)系(即前后件關(guān)系)的數(shù)據(jù)結(jié)構(gòu)。它包括兩個(gè)要素,數(shù)據(jù)元素的集合和數(shù)據(jù)元素之間的關(guān)系。
(2)數(shù)據(jù)的存儲(chǔ)結(jié)構(gòu)。
數(shù)據(jù)的邏輯結(jié)構(gòu)在計(jì)算機(jī)存儲(chǔ)空間中的存放形式稱(chēng)為數(shù)據(jù)的存儲(chǔ)結(jié)構(gòu)(也稱(chēng)為數(shù)據(jù)的物理結(jié)構(gòu))。數(shù)據(jù)結(jié)構(gòu)的存儲(chǔ)方式包括順序存儲(chǔ)方法、鏈?zhǔn)酱鎯?chǔ)方法、索引存儲(chǔ)方法和散列存儲(chǔ)方法。而采用不同的存儲(chǔ)結(jié)構(gòu),其數(shù)據(jù)處理的效率是不同的。因此,在進(jìn)行數(shù)據(jù)處理時(shí),選擇合適的存儲(chǔ)結(jié)構(gòu)是很重要的。
數(shù)據(jù)結(jié)構(gòu)研究的內(nèi)容主要包括3個(gè)方面:
●數(shù)據(jù)集合中各數(shù)據(jù)元素之間的邏輯關(guān)系,即數(shù)據(jù)的邏輯結(jié)構(gòu);
●在對(duì)數(shù)據(jù)進(jìn)行處理時(shí),各數(shù)據(jù)元素在計(jì)算機(jī)中的存儲(chǔ)關(guān)系,即數(shù)據(jù)的存儲(chǔ)結(jié)構(gòu);
●對(duì)各種數(shù)據(jù)結(jié)構(gòu)進(jìn)行的運(yùn)算。
2.數(shù)據(jù)結(jié)構(gòu)的圖形表示
數(shù)據(jù)元素之間最基本的關(guān)系是前后件關(guān)系。前后件關(guān)系,即每一個(gè)二元組,都可以用圖形來(lái)表示。用中間標(biāo)有元素值的方框表示數(shù)據(jù)元素,一般稱(chēng)為數(shù)據(jù)節(jié)點(diǎn),簡(jiǎn)稱(chēng)為節(jié)點(diǎn)。對(duì)于每一個(gè)二元組,用一條有向線段從前件指向后件。
圖形表示數(shù)據(jù)結(jié)構(gòu)具有直觀易懂的特點(diǎn),在不引起歧義的情況下,前件節(jié)點(diǎn)到后件節(jié)點(diǎn)連線上的箭頭可以省略。例如,樹(shù)型結(jié)構(gòu)中,通常都是用無(wú)向線段來(lái)表示前后件關(guān)系的。
3.線性結(jié)構(gòu)與非線性結(jié)構(gòu)
根據(jù)數(shù)據(jù)結(jié)構(gòu)中各數(shù)據(jù)元素之間前后件關(guān)系的復(fù)雜程度,一般將數(shù)據(jù)結(jié)構(gòu)分為兩大類(lèi)型,即線性結(jié)構(gòu)和非線性結(jié)構(gòu)。
如果一個(gè)非空的數(shù)據(jù)結(jié)構(gòu)滿(mǎn)足有且只有一個(gè)根節(jié)點(diǎn),并且每個(gè)節(jié)點(diǎn)最多有一個(gè)前件,也最多有一個(gè)后件,則稱(chēng)該數(shù)據(jù)結(jié)構(gòu)為線性結(jié)構(gòu),又稱(chēng)線性表。如果不滿(mǎn)足上述條件的數(shù)據(jù)結(jié)構(gòu)則稱(chēng)為非線性結(jié)構(gòu)。
真考鏈接
考核概率為45%。考生要熟記該考點(diǎn)的內(nèi)容,尤其是數(shù)據(jù)結(jié)構(gòu)的定義、分類(lèi),能區(qū)分線性結(jié)構(gòu)與非線性結(jié)構(gòu)。
小提示
需要注意的是,在一個(gè)線性結(jié)構(gòu)中插入或刪除任何一個(gè)節(jié)點(diǎn)后還應(yīng)該是線性結(jié)構(gòu)。否則,不能稱(chēng)為線性結(jié)構(gòu)。
真題精選
下列敘述中正確的是______。
A)程序執(zhí)行的效率與數(shù)據(jù)的存儲(chǔ)結(jié)構(gòu)密切相關(guān)
B)程序執(zhí)行的效率只取決于程序的控制結(jié)構(gòu)
C)程序執(zhí)行的效率只取決于所處理的數(shù)據(jù)量
D)以上三種說(shuō)法都不對(duì)
【答案】A
【解析】在計(jì)算機(jī)中,數(shù)據(jù)的存儲(chǔ)結(jié)構(gòu)對(duì)數(shù)據(jù)的執(zhí)行效率有較大影響,如在有序存儲(chǔ)的表中查找某個(gè)數(shù)值比在無(wú)序存儲(chǔ)的表中查找的效率高很多。
- 全國(guó)職稱(chēng)計(jì)算機(jī)考試講義·真題·預(yù)測(cè)三合一:中文Windows XP操作系統(tǒng)
- 全國(guó)計(jì)算機(jī)等級(jí)考試歷年真題與機(jī)考題庫(kù):二級(jí)MS Office高級(jí)應(yīng)用
- 全國(guó)計(jì)算機(jī)等級(jí)考試真題匯編與專(zhuān)用題庫(kù):二級(jí)Access
- 2020年3月全國(guó)計(jì)算機(jī)等級(jí)考試《四級(jí)軟件工程》復(fù)習(xí)全書(shū)【核心講義+歷年真題詳解】
- 2020年3月全國(guó)計(jì)算機(jī)等級(jí)考試《四級(jí)數(shù)據(jù)庫(kù)原理》復(fù)習(xí)全書(shū)【核心講義+歷年真題詳解】
- 黑光造型:創(chuàng)意造型設(shè)計(jì)佳作賞析
- 5天通過(guò)職稱(chēng)計(jì)算機(jī)考試(考點(diǎn)視頻串講+全真模擬):PowerPoint 2003中文演示文稿(第2版) (全國(guó)專(zhuān)業(yè)技術(shù)人員計(jì)算機(jī)應(yīng)用能力考試指導(dǎo)叢書(shū))
- 全國(guó)計(jì)算機(jī)等級(jí)考試《二級(jí)C語(yǔ)言程序設(shè)計(jì)》【教材精講+真題解析】講義與視頻課程【45小時(shí)高清視頻】
- 2024年全國(guó)計(jì)算機(jī)等級(jí)考試模擬考場(chǎng)二級(jí)C語(yǔ)言
- 5天通過(guò)職稱(chēng)計(jì)算機(jī)考試(考點(diǎn)視頻串講+全真模擬):Word 2003中文字處理(第2版) (全國(guó)專(zhuān)業(yè)技術(shù)人員計(jì)算機(jī)應(yīng)用能力考試指導(dǎo)叢書(shū))
- 全國(guó)計(jì)算機(jī)等級(jí)考試上機(jī)專(zhuān)用題庫(kù)與筆試模擬考場(chǎng):二級(jí)Visual Basic
- 信息技術(shù)計(jì)算機(jī)等級(jí)考試模塊(一級(jí)MS Office)
- 全國(guó)計(jì)算機(jī)等級(jí)考試歷年真題與機(jī)考題庫(kù):三級(jí)網(wǎng)絡(luò)技術(shù)
- 2020年3月全國(guó)計(jì)算機(jī)等級(jí)考試《四級(jí)操作系統(tǒng)原理》復(fù)習(xí)全書(shū)【核心講義+歷年真題詳解】
- 2024年全國(guó)計(jì)算機(jī)等級(jí)考試上機(jī)考試題庫(kù)二級(jí)Python